People for April 2004.
New Positions
Rep. Joe Barton, R-Texas, stepped into the role of chairman of the House Energy and Commerce Committee, succeeding Rep. Billy Tauzin, R-La., who is leaving Congress.
Duke Energy named David Hauser as its permanent CFO. He had been acting CFO since November. He succeeds Robert Brace, who resigned.
Entergy named Leo Denault executive vice president and CFO, replacing C. John Wilder, who assumed the role of CEO at TXU Corp. Denault has been with Entergy since 1999. Wilder's predecessor, Erle Nye, will remain as chairman of TXU's board until next May. TXU also said Dr. Gail de Planque had joined its board of directors.
American Electric Power Co. appointed Michael Morris as its chairman, succeeding E. Linn Draper Jr., who plans to exit the company by April of this year, Reuters says. Morris was serving as the company's CEO at the time of his appointment to the chairmanship.
